The U.S. Department of Energy (DoE) Commercial Heat Pump Accelerator program is designed to enhance building efficiency and electrification. Running from 2024 through 2027, the program aims to overcome adoption barriers, promote advanced heat pump technologies, and create sustainable solutions for HVAC professionals. Ziehl-Abegg, Inc is the North American subsidiary of Ziehl-Abegg SE based in Kunzelsau, Germany. It is headquartered in Winston-Salem, NC. With additional offices throughout the US, one in Mexico and three in Canada. Ziehl-Abegg is one of the leading global companies in the field of ventilation, control and drive technology. In the 1950s, Ziehl-Abegg established the basis for modern fan drives: external rotor motors which even today are still seen as state-of-the-art worldwide. Emil Ziehl founded the company in 1910 as a manufacturer of electric motors. It remains a family-owned business.

Nomad Go AI Gives Your HVAC Superpowers Computer vision and AI is used to capture live occupancy, IoT, and third-party data to control your existing HVAC system in real-time, replacing static schedules. Instead of heating, cooling, and ventilating empty rooms, Nomad Go controls your HVAC based on the number of people in the space, reducing energy consumption and CO2 emissions to only when rooms are occupied.
